Inhibition by chlorhexidine of alveolar bone loss in mice
Journal of Periodontal Research, 1980Use of 0.2 % chlorhexidine gluconate as a mouthrinse 5 times per week for 6 months inhibited alveolar bone loss by more than 40 % in a strain of periodontal disease‐susceptible mice.

[Prevention of alveolar bone loss].
Revue belge de medecine dentaire, 1992This article describes the bone resorption and remodeling of the edentulous jaw, starting right after extraction of teeth. This resorption is a physiological process, but can be influenced by wearing dentures. Load on the mucosa and disturbed blood circulation of the mucosa caused by the denture gives an additional bone resorption.

Inhibition of alveolar bone loss in beagles with the NSAID naproxen
Journal of Periodontal Research, 1991The non‐steroidal anti‐inflammatory drug(NSAID) naproxen was studied in 11 beagle dogs over a 13‐month period to determine its effect on the progression of periodontitis. Following a 6‐month pretreatment period, 5 dogs received naproxen daily at a dosage of 2.0 mg/kg for 1 month, then 0.2 mg/kg for 6 months.
